[AIS] Met/Hydro: fixes and improvements

diff --git a/driver_ais.c b/driver_ais.c index 68e8e698..992063a3 100644 --- a/driver_ais.c +++ b/driver_ais.c @@ -10,6 +10,7 @@ * For the special IMO messages (types 6 and 8), only the following have been * tested against known-good decodings: * - IMO236 met/hydro message: Type=8, DAC=1, FI=11 + * - IMO289 met/hydro message: Type=8, DAC=1, FI=31 * * This file is Copyright (c) 2010 by the GPSD project * BSD terms apply: see the file COPYING in the distribution root for details. @@ -31,11 +32,8 @@ #define DAC1FID11_LEVEL_OFFSET 100 #define DAC1FID11_WATERTEMP_OFFSET 100 -#define DAC1FID31_AIRTEMP_OFFSET 600 -#define DAC1FID31_DEWPOINT_OFFSET 200 -#define DAC1FID31_PRESSURE_OFFSET -800 -#define DAC1FID31_LEVEL_OFFSET 100 -#define DAC1FID31_WATERTEMP_OFFSET 100 +#define DAC1FID31_PRESSURE_OFFSET -799 +#define DAC1FID31_LEVEL_OFFSET 1000 static void from_sixbit(char *bitvec, uint start, int count, char *to) { @@ -543,8 +541,8 @@ bool ais_binary_decode(struct ais_t *ais, ais->type8.dac1fid29.text); break; case 31: /* IMO289 - Meteorological/Hydrological data */ - ais->type8.dac1fid31.lat = SBITS(56, 24); - ais->type8.dac1fid31.lon = SBITS(80, 25); + ais->type8.dac1fid31.lon = SBITS(56, 25); + ais->type8.dac1fid31.lat = SBITS(81, 24); ais->type8.dac1fid31.accuracy = (bool)UBITS(105, 1); ais->type8.dac1fid31.day = UBITS(106, 5); ais->type8.dac1fid31.hour = UBITS(111, 5); @@ -553,17 +551,15 @@ bool ais_binary_decode(struct ais_t *ais, ais->type8.dac1fid31.wgust = UBITS(129, 7); ais->type8.dac1fid31.wdir = UBITS(136, 9); ais->type8.dac1fid31.wgustdir = UBITS(145, 9); - ais->type8.dac1fid31.airtemp = SBITS(154, 11) - - DAC1FID31_AIRTEMP_OFFSET; + ais->type8.dac1fid31.airtemp = SBITS(154, 11); ais->type8.dac1fid31.humidity = UBITS(165, 7); - ais->type8.dac1fid31.dewpoint = UBITS(172, 10) - - DAC1FID31_DEWPOINT_OFFSET; + ais->type8.dac1fid31.dewpoint = SBITS(172, 10); ais->type8.dac1fid31.pressure = UBITS(182, 9) - DAC1FID31_PRESSURE_OFFSET; ais->type8.dac1fid31.pressuretend = UBITS(191, 2); ais->type8.dac1fid31.visgreater = UBITS(193, 1); ais->type8.dac1fid31.visibility = UBITS(194, 7); - ais->type8.dac1fid31.waterlevel = UBITS(200, 12) + ais->type8.dac1fid31.waterlevel = UBITS(201, 12) - DAC1FID31_LEVEL_OFFSET; ais->type8.dac1fid31.leveltrend = UBITS(213, 2); ais->type8.dac1fid31.cspeed = UBITS(215, 8); @@ -581,8 +577,7 @@ bool ais_binary_decode(struct ais_t *ais, ais->type8.dac1fid31.swellperiod = UBITS(307, 6); ais->type8.dac1fid31.swelldir = UBITS(313, 9); ais->type8.dac1fid31.seastate = UBITS(322, 4); - ais->type8.dac1fid31.watertemp = UBITS(326, 10) - - DAC1FID31_WATERTEMP_OFFSET; + ais->type8.dac1fid31.watertemp = SBITS(326, 10); ais->type8.dac1fid31.preciptype = UBITS(336, 3); ais->type8.dac1fid31.salinity = UBITS(339, 9); ais->type8.dac1fid31.ice = UBITS(348, 2); |
